MADISON COUNTY DEVELOPMENT GROUP, founded in 1987, is a small nonprofit that reported $174K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Expenses of $157K left a modest 10% surplus.

Mission

TO ATTRACT BUSINESSES TO LOCATE IN MADISON COUNTY, IOWA
